Vlsi Platform for Real-world Intelligent Integrated Systems Based on Algorithm Selection
Abstract
A real-world intelligent system consists of three basic modules: environment recognition, prediction (or estimation), an d behavior planning. To obtain high quality results in these modules, high speed processing and real time adaptability on a case by case basis are required. In each of the above mentioned modules, many different algorithms and algorithms networks exists an d provide various performances on a case by case basis. Thus, a mechanism that for any of the three computational stages selects the best possible algorithm is required. We propose a platform based on the algorithm selection approach to the problem of natu ral image understanding. This selection mechanism is based on machine learning; a bottom -up algorithm selection from real -world image features and a top -down algorithm selection using information obtained from a high level symbolic world description and al gorithm suitability. To accommodate the high -speed processing requirements, the high -frequency of real -time reconfiguration and a low -cost of implementation, we are using present a novel dynamic reconfigurable VLSI processor for real-time adaptation of the algorithm selection. The new architecture includes a fine - grain Digital Reconfigurable Processor, a distributed configuration memory to solve the data transfer bottleneck and an intra-chip packet routing scheme to reduce the size of the configuration memory.
